What is the Right of First Refusal Agreement?

The Right of First Refusal Agreement is a legal document that establishes a priority for business transactions between two parties. This agreement is significant as it grants one party the opportunity to refuse or accept a business transaction before it is offered to any third party. Its importance lies in creating trust and clarity in business partnerships, ensuring that both parties can negotiate terms without misunderstanding.
This agreement typically outlines the circumstances under which a right of first refusal is applicable and serves to protect both parties by defining their rights and responsibilities in a business context.

Purpose and Benefits of the Right of First Refusal Agreement

The primary purpose of this agreement is to provide mutual protection for the parties involved in a business transaction. By establishing clear terms, it prevents potential misunderstandings that can arise in negotiations and business dealings.
  • Helps in maintaining a strong business partnership by setting expectations.
  • Facilitates smoother negotiations and decision-making processes.
  • Encourages fairness and transparency in future business dealings.
